Abstract: For logistics service integrator (LSI), in a dynamic market, the only effective way for logistics enterprise obtaining greater benefits is to continue innovating and maintaining dynamic capabilities. In the use of sub-model multidimensional approach, we proposed that the dynamic capacity composed by the environmental awareness, resource integration capability and logistics flexibility capability. The paper gives the dynamic capability measure, the concept definition of LSI, how it affects the ability to build dynamic growth performance LSI growth models, and make an empirical analysis. It also finalise the structural model that dynamic capabilities impact on LSI growth performance. Then, we construct the model of the effect of dynamic capability on the growth performance of LSI. We deeply analyse mechanism of factors that affect growth merits of logistic service.
